Derek Jackson
derekjackson6
- Nicholson
- https://koreanaggies.net/board_Lmao72/1918482
-
Hi there! :) My name is Derek, I'm a student studying Computer Science from Nicholson, Australia.
- Joined on Aug 13, 2025
Updated 1 day ago